Definitions:

Immobilized

Restriction of movement, often by mechanical means or medical devices, to allow healing or prevent further injury.

Supine Position

A way of lying down where the person is on their back, facing upwards, often used in medical contexts.

Hypercalcemia

A condition characterized by an abnormally high level of calcium in the blood, which can cause various symptoms and require medical management.

Renal Calculi

Also known as kidney stones; these are hard deposits of minerals and salts that form inside the kidneys.
